Dr. Livescu is a professor in the Department of Geothermal Studies at the University of Texas at Austin, SPE technical director for data science and engineering analytics, and editor-in-chief, Elsevier Geoenergy Science and Engineering. He has conducted fundamental and applied research, multidisciplinary research and technology development, diversified innovation, intellectual property, and management applied to several petroleum engineering and clean energy technical disciplines, with a focus on well engineering and operations (monitoring and telemetry systems, well intervention, stimulation, construction, production, and data science and engineering analytics). He is strongly committed to helping solve some of the most impactful energy transition and digital transformation problems for a net-zero, sustainable and affordable energy future. Birol Dindoruk is currently a Professor and AADE Endowed professor in Petroleum Engineering at the University of Houston, USA. He is also currently Editor-in-Chief of Elsevier’s Journal of Natural Gas Science and Engineering. Birol previously worked at Shell for over 35 years as a Chief Scientist of Reservoir Physics, one of seven allotted in the company. He received a B.Sc. in petroleum engineering from the Technical University of Istanbul, a Engineering MSc from Bogazici University, a MSc in petroleum engineering from the University of Alabama, a MBA from the University of Houston, and a PhD in petroleum engineering from Stanford. Birol has published well over 130 publications and is active in many associations, including Society of Petroleum Engineers.
